You know I'm not sure if it's distortion or what. My signal chain was just my Blue Blueberry mic into my Presonus Eureka preamp into my interface. But I don't think she had a good headphone mix and was standing too far off the mic, so I got a pretty weak signal. I think boosting the track just raised the noise floor too much and plus the A/C was running. Bottom line, it was a rush job and I hope I can redo it. Thanks BIABDude!!
